Welcome aboard! Plugins built for the Marblewick exchange pull nightly partner feeds from our SFTP drop, hosted by the Fennimore platform team. Your plugin just needs read access to the inbound folder; we rotate the drop credentials quarterly, so don't hardcode anything. Add the drop passphrase to your plugin's .env file as the following line:

vault entry, hahaf-tafog: VAULT_KEY3=38a

Dear plugin authors, we are writing to inform you of an ownership change for the Garagepulse parking-garage occupancy feed. Effective next Monday, maintenance of the feed schema, rate limits, and deprecation notices moves from the Platform Integrations group to the Mobility Data team. Please review your polling intervals before the transition, as the new team will enforce the documented limits strictly. All schema-change proposals and compatibility questions should now be directed to the feed's new owner.

named custodian: Oliath Ralax

## Deploying the Gatewick Proctor Queue

Deploys are pretty painless: push to main, wait for the pipeline, then watch the queue drain dashboard for five minutes. If candidates pile up mid-exam, roll back first and ask questions later — the queue replays safely. Everything the workers care about lives in one config block, shown here for reference.

settings of bafof-yagef:
JOROX_PIN=8740
JOROX_TENANT=pelox
JOROX_METRICS_HOST=metrics.jorox.qorvelworks.internal
JOROX_SEAL=seal_c78f63c1
JOROX_STANDBY_TEAM=norax

Subject: Support outsourcing — decision made

Team,

We're moving Tier-1 support for the Vantrell product line to Corvane Services, starting Q2. Sales leads: brief your accounts before the transition window opens. Tier-2 stays in-house at the Dunmarsh hub. Expect a 30% cost reduction and faster coverage across time zones. Escalation paths unchanged. Objections to me by Friday; after that we sign.

One more thing — the rationale ties directly into what's outlined below.

— Petra Holving, VP Operations

board note of bawep-tajef: Queniusek Systems plans to raise the Quenvan list price by 53.1 percent in March. The pricing group signed off on a budget of $176.4 million for Project Drueth. The renewal with Casionix Partners closes at $142.5 million a year, 8.3 percent below the last contract. Project Fraax slips by six weeks because of the tooling delay.